The Riviera was the hotel where cast and crew stayed during the 7 weeks Las Vegas shoot. It's where Bond met Plenty O’Toole at the gambling tables where also the scene was filmed with Sammy Davis Jr., which eventually ended up on the floor of the cutting room. The Riviera will be demolished to make way for convention and meeting facilities.

Bond was born in 1952 when Fleming, a former naval intelligence officer, penned his first draft of Casino Royale at his Jamaican villa, GoldenEye (named after a wartime plan ...In the film, James Bond is sent to Jamaica to investigate the disappearance of a fellow British agent. The trail leads him to the underground base of Dr Julius No, who is plotting to disrupt an American space launch from Cape Canaveral with a radio beam weapon. Produced on a low budget, Dr No was a financial success.Web

Goldeneye is the original name of novelist Ian Fleming's estate on Oracabessa Bay on the northern coastline of Jamaica.He bought 15 acres (6.1 ha) adjacent to the Golden Clouds estate in 1946 and built his home on the edge of a cliff overlooking a private beach. The three-bedroom structure was constructed from Fleming's sketch, fitted with …WebFind out more. You see, I’m in GoldenEye sitting at James Bond’s birthplace, which is a small ...San Monique is a small fictional country in the Caribbean Islands. The ruthless Dr. Kananga served as its head of government and Prime Minister until his death at the hands of James Bond. The location first appeared in the 1973 James Bond film Live and Let Die, and was subsequently re-imagined for the 1984 tabletop role-playing game James Bond 007, and …WebGoldenEye Hotel & Resort on Jamaica's north coast in the village of Oracabessa. The 52-acre property is the former home of author Ian Fleming, creator of James Bond. Chris Blackwell, the founder of Island Records and the Island Outpost collection of five Jamaican properties, purchased GoldenEye in 1976.Web
